As I stood in my kitchen, surrounded by the tantalizing aroma of melted chocolate, I had an epiphany: what if I fused this luxurious treat with the delightful flavors of Middle Eastern pastries? Enter my latest obsession—Addictive Dubai Chocolate Balls with Pistachio Cream. The marriage of rich chocolate and creamy pistachio filling, all wrapped in a crunchy kataifi pastry, creates a dessert that not only satisfies sweet cravings but also makes for a stunning presentation at gatherings. This quick and easy recipe transforms everyday ingredients into an exotic delight you can whip up in just 30 minutes. Perfect for impressing guests or simply treating yourself, these decadent chocolate balls are the ultimate no-bake indulgence. Are you ready to elevate your dessert game and explore a sensational fusion of flavors? Let’s dive in!

Why Will You Love These Chocolate Balls?
Exotic Flavors: Each bite transports you to the bustling streets of Dubai, offering a delightful combination of rich chocolate and creamy pistachio in a unique kataifi shell.
Quick and Easy: With just 30 minutes of prep time, these no-bake treats are perfect for anyone craving a homemade dessert without the hassle.
Crowd-Pleaser: Serve them at gatherings, and watch as guests rave about their irresistible crunch and exquisite flavor—ideal for parties or cozy get-togethers!
Versatile Options: Feel free to swap in your favorite nuts or flavorings for the filling; variations like my Peanut Butter Chocolate or High Protein Chocolate can also inspire creativity in the kitchen.
Gourmet Presentation: They look stunning on any dessert table, making them a visually appealing choice that highlights your culinary skills.
Manageable Indulgence: At around 152 calories per serving, you can enjoy these decadent chocolate balls knowing they’re a treat worth savoring.
Dubai Chocolate Balls Ingredients
For the Pistachio Filling
• White Chocolate – Adds sweetness and creaminess; dark chocolate can be used for a richer flavor.
• Double Cream – Provides a silky texture; substitute with heavy cream if needed.
• Ground Pistachios – Gives a nutty finish; swap with almonds or walnuts for a different taste.
• Salt – Enhances the flavor of the chocolate and cream.
For the Kataifi Pastry
• Kataifi Pastry – Adds a unique crunchy texture; use shredded phyllo dough as an alternative.
• Butter – Used for toasting kataifi for added flavor.
• All-Purpose Flour – Contributes to the structure of the pastry; gluten-free flour can substitute for a gluten-free option.
• Cornstarch – Enhances the pastry’s texture, making it crispier.
• Sugar – Sweetens the kataifi mixture; consider a sugar alternative for less sweetness.
• Vegetable Oil – Adds moisture and richness to the kataifi.
• Water – Hydrates the dough mixture.
For the Coating
• Milk Chocolate – Creates a delicious coating for the chocolate balls; dark chocolate can intensify the flavor.
• Chopped Pistachios – Used as a topping to add crunch and a nutty flair.
These ingredients come together to create irresistible Dubai Chocolate Balls that balance richness with delightful textures. Enjoy the process of making this no-bake treat that is sure to impress!
Step‑by‑Step Instructions for Dubai Chocolate Balls
Step 1: Prepare Kataifi Pastry
In a bowl, whisk together flour, cornstarch, sugar, and salt. Gradually mix in 2 tablespoons of vegetable oil and enough water to create a smooth batter. Let the mixture rest for 30 minutes. Heat a nonstick pan over medium and pipe thin layers of the batter onto it. Cook until dry but not browned, then transfer to a towel. Repeat until all the batter is used, then allow the kataifi to cool.
Step 2: Make Pistachio Cream
Melt 100g of white chocolate with 100ml of double cream in the microwave for about 30 seconds, stirring until smooth. Blend 50g of ground pistachios and a pinch of salt into a fine paste, then fold this into the melted chocolate mixture. In a separate pan, toast the cooled kataifi with 2 tablespoons of butter over medium heat until golden, about 5 minutes, and mix it into the pistachio cream. Chill for 1 hour.
Step 3: Shape and Coat
Once the pistachio cream mixture is chilled and firm, scoop and roll it into small balls, about 1 inch in diameter. Melt 200g of milk chocolate in a heatproof bowl over simmering water until fully liquid. Dip each ball into the melted chocolate, allowing any excess to drip off, then place them on parchment paper. To add texture, sprinkle the tops with chopped pistachios before refrigerating until the chocolate is set.

Make Ahead Options
These addictive Dubai Chocolate Balls are perfect for meal prep enthusiasts! You can prepare the pistachio cream filling up to 24 hours in advance, just make sure to store it in an airtight container in the refrigerator to keep it fresh and creamy. Additionally, you can toast the kataifi pastry ahead of time; just seal it tightly to maintain its crunchy texture. When you’re ready to serve, simply roll the chilled pistachio filling into balls, dip them in melted milk chocolate, and garnish with chopped pistachios. This way, you can have a gourmet dessert ready to impress with minimal effort, making your busy weeknights a little sweeter!
Dubai Chocolate Balls Variations
Feel free to explore these delightful variations to enhance your Dubai Chocolate Balls experience!
-
Nutty Twist: Replace ground pistachios with almonds or hazelnuts for a different flavor profile. Each nut brings its unique charm to the chocolate.
-
Dark Chocolate Delight: Use dark chocolate for both the filling and coating. This swap results in a richer, more decadent treat that chocolate lovers will appreciate.
-
Coconut Cream: Substitute the pistachio cream with a coconut cream filling for a tropical twist. The creamy coconut complements the chocolate beautifully.
-
Flavor Infusion: Add a drop of rose water or orange blossom water to the cream for an exotic aroma. This subtle flavor will transport you straight to a Middle Eastern bazaar.
-
Apricot Surprise: Incorporate finely chopped dried apricots into the pistachio filling for a fruity burst. This combination will surely add a new layer of texture and flavor.
-
Spicy Kick: Introduce a hint of chili powder to the chocolate coating for a surprising heat. This bold contrast with the sweetness makes for a thrilling dessert experience.
-
Creamy Alternative: If you’re looking for a vegan option, use coconut cream and dairy-free chocolate to create a plant-based version of these delightful treats. They’re just as delicious!
-
Mini Bites: Roll the mixture into smaller balls for bite-sized delights that are perfect for sharing. These mini versions are great for parties, ensuring everyone can take a taste.
To inspire even more culinary creativity, check out my Chocolate Chip Banana recipe or enjoy some Ingredient Chocolate Oat cookies as a fun alternative!
Expert Tips for Dubai Chocolate Balls
-
Chill for Firmness: Ensure the pistachio cream is well-chilled before shaping; this makes rolling the Dubai Chocolate Balls easier and prevents messy hands.
-
Mind the Heat: When toasting kataifi, keep the heat low. Too high can brown the pastry, resulting in a tough texture instead of the desired lightness.
-
Chocolate Dipping: Use a toothpick to dip each ball in melted chocolate; this creates a neat finish and keeps your fingers clean during the process.
-
Taste Test: Before chilling, taste the pistachio cream and adjust sweetness or salt levels as needed to enhance the overall flavor of your chocolate balls.
-
Experiment with Nuts: Feel free to swap in different nuts for the filling or garnish; almonds or hazelnuts can add a delightful twist to your Dubai Chocolate Balls.
What to Serve with Addictive Dubai Chocolate Balls
Indulging in exotic flavors is best enjoyed by pairing these delightful treats with complementary sides that enhance your sweet experience.
-
Fresh Berries: A medley of raspberries and strawberries adds a burst of tartness, balancing the rich chocolate and creamy pistachio. Their juicy freshness wonderfully contrasts the dessert’s creamy texture.
-
Vanilla Ice Cream: The classic pairing of creamy vanilla ice cream brings a coolness that perfectly complements the warmth of the chocolate. Scoop a dollop alongside these chocolate balls for an indulgent dessert couple.
-
Mint Tea: A refreshing cup of mint tea cleanses the palate and offers a light, fragrant finish to the chocolatey indulgence. Its soothing notes harmonize beautifully with every rich bite.
-
Pistachio Crumble: A sprinkle of finely chopped pistachios brings an extra crunch. This nutty addition mirrors the flavor within the chocolate balls while elevating presentation.
-
Coffee or Espresso: A robust cup of coffee enhances the chocolate experience, allowing the deep flavors to shine. The bitterness of the coffee contrasts beautifully with the sweetness of the dessert.
-
Chocolate Dipped Fruit: Elevate your dessert table by serving chocolate-dipped fruits like bananas or strawberries. Their natural sweetness pairs brilliantly with the Dubai Chocolate Balls, creating a lovely balance of textures.
-
Coconut Macaroons: These chewy treats provide a sweet and nutty addition. The coconut’s tropical essence enhances the exotic vibes of your dessert spread.
-
Almond Milkshake: For a fun twist, serve a chilled almond milkshake that echoes the nutty flavors of the chocolate balls while providing a creamy, delicious sip.
-
Whipped Cream: A dollop of freshly whipped cream adds a light, airy complement to the rich chocolate. This classic addition enhances the decadence of your Dubai Chocolate Balls.
Storage Tips for Dubai Chocolate Balls
Fridge: Store in an airtight container in the refrigerator for up to 5 days to maintain freshness and flavor.
Freezer: For longer preservation, freeze the Dubai Chocolate Balls for up to 1 month. Ensure layers are separated with parchment paper to prevent sticking.
Thawing: When ready to enjoy, thaw in the fridge overnight for best results or leave at room temperature for about 30 minutes.
Reheating: These treats are best served chilled; avoid reheating as it may affect the texture and taste of the chocolate.

Dubai Chocolate Balls Recipe FAQs
What type of pistachios should I use for the filling?
I recommend using lightly salted, high-quality roasted pistachios for the best flavor in your filling. You can also use unsalted pistachios if you prefer a sweeter filling, or try substituting with almonds or walnuts for a different nutty twist!
How should I store the Dubai Chocolate Balls to keep them fresh?
Store your Dubai Chocolate Balls in an airtight container in the refrigerator for up to 5 days. This keeps them fresh and maintains the texture of both the chocolate coating and pistachio filling. Make sure to layer them with parchment paper if you’re stacking them to avoid sticking!
Can I freeze Dubai Chocolate Balls, and if so, how?
Absolutely! You can freeze Dubai Chocolate Balls for up to 1 month. To freeze, place them in a single layer on a baking sheet lined with parchment paper and freeze until solid. Then, transfer them to an airtight container, separating layers with parchment paper to prevent sticking. When you’re ready to enjoy, thaw in the refrigerator overnight for the best texture.
What if my kataifi pastry gets too brown while cooking?
If your kataifi pastry starts to brown, it means the heat is too high. To achieve a soft and crunchy texture, keep the heat low to medium when cooking. If it does brown, you can still use it, but try to limit cooking time to just until dry, around 1-2 minutes per side for the ideal outcome.
Are there any dietary considerations for this recipe?
Yes! If you or your guests have nut allergies, make sure to substitute the pistachios with seeds like sunflower or pumpkin seeds, and check chocolate labels for any allergens. For gluten-free options, you can replace all-purpose flour in the kataifi with gluten-free flour.
What’s the best way to serve the Dubai Chocolate Balls?
These delightful treats are best served chilled. They make a stunning dessert at gatherings or parties! Arrange them on a decorative platter and sprinkle additional chopped pistachios on top for an appealing presentation. Enjoy!

Irresistible Dubai Chocolate Balls with Pistachio Bliss
Ingredients
Equipment
Method
- In a bowl, whisk together flour, cornstarch, sugar, and salt. Gradually mix in vegetable oil and enough water to create a smooth batter. Let the mixture rest for 30 minutes. Heat a nonstick pan over medium and pipe thin layers of the batter onto it. Cook until dry but not browned, then transfer to a towel. Repeat until all the batter is used, then allow the kataifi to cool.
- Melt white chocolate with double cream in the microwave for about 30 seconds, stirring until smooth. Blend ground pistachios and a pinch of salt into a fine paste, then fold into the melted chocolate. Toast the cooled kataifi with butter over medium heat until golden, about 5 minutes, and mix it into the pistachio cream. Chill for 1 hour.
- Scoop and roll the pistachio cream mixture into small balls, about 1 inch in diameter. Melt milk chocolate in a heatproof bowl over simmering water until fully liquid. Dip each ball into the melted chocolate, allowing excess to drip off, then place on parchment paper. Sprinkle tops with chopped pistachios before refrigerating until chocolate is set.

Leave a Reply